    Position Overview

    Supports dispatch workflow, load planning, and shipment tracking across Oregon-based operations. Minneapolis candidates are prioritized for hybrid participation; remote candidates are fully integrated nationwide. Entry-level candidates receive structured training; experienced professionals manage operational responsibilities independently.

    Key Responsibilities

    Assign and track freight loads using dispatch systems

    Monitor shipment progress and maintain operational documentation

    Communicate shipment updates, delays, or exceptions to internal teams and drivers

    Maintain detailed dispatch logs and operational records

    Identify workflow inefficiencies and propose improvements

    Collaborate with Oregon-based management for operational alignment

    Escalate scheduling conflicts or operational issues as necessary
